Law amending Law on Security Guard Force 2024 available in Vietnam

June 28, 2024, the National Assembly of Vietnam approved the Law amending Law on Security Guard Force 2024, which amended several notable provisions.

Law amending Law on Security Guard Force 2024 was approved by the 15th National Assembly of the Socialist Republic of Vietnam, 7th session on June 21, 2024.

Law amending Law on Security Guard Force 2024 available in Vietnam

Law amending Law on Security Guard Force 2024 will amend and supplement several provisions of the Law on Security Guard Force 2017 as follows:

(1) Amend and supplement several clauses of Article 3 as follows:

- Amend and supplement Clause 4 as follows:

“4. Protected subjects are individuals holding key leadership positions, including high-ranking leaders of the Communist Party of Vietnam, the State of the Socialist Republic of Vietnam, and the Central Committee of the Vietnam Fatherland Front; international guests visiting and working in Vietnam; critical areas; events of special importance and other subjects to which protective measures and policies are applied as stipulated in this Law.”;

- Add Clauses 7, 8, 9, and 10 after Clause 6 as follows:

“7. The protection regime comprises the policies that the Communist Party of Vietnam, the State of the Socialist Republic of Vietnam provide to the protected subjects specified in this Law.

  1. Security and safety inspections are protective measures applied by the Protection Forces to detect weapons, explosives, support tools, flammable substances, biological toxins, chemical toxins, radioactive substances, and other factors to promptly prevent and counter security threats and safety risks to the protected subjects.

  2. Food and drink testing are protective measures applied by the Protection Forces to promptly prevent, detect, and counter the risk of poisoning and contamination from food and drinks.

  3. Use of identification cards and badges is a protective measure applied by the Protection Forces to check and control individuals and vehicles entering and exiting the protected areas.”

(2) Add Clause 3 after Clause 2 in Article 6 as follows:

“3. The Government of Vietnam shall provide detailed regulations for Clause 2 of this Article.”

(3) Amend and supplement several clauses of Article 10 as follows:

- Amend and supplement the introductory sentence of Clause 1 as follows:

“1. Individuals holding key leadership positions, including high-ranking leaders of the Communist Party of Vietnam, the State of the Socialist Republic of Vietnam, and the Central Committee of the Vietnam Fatherland Front include:”

- Amend and supplement Points e, g, and h of Clause 1 as follows:

“e) Executive Members of the Secretariat, Members of the Politburo;

g) Members of the Secretariat;

h) President of the Central Committee of the Vietnam Fatherland Front, Chief Justice of the Supreme People's Court, Head of the Supreme People's Procuracy, Vice President, Vice Chairman of the National Assembly, Deputy Prime Minister of the Government of Vietnam.”

c) Amend and supplement Point b of Clause 2 as follows:

“b) Deputies of the heads of state, legislative bodies, and the Government of Vietnam on the principle of reciprocity, diplomatic requirements.”

d) Amend and supplement Point d of Clause 2 as follows:

“d) Other guests at the request of the Head of the Central Committee for Foreign Relations, the Chairperson of the National Assembly's Foreign Affairs Committee, or the Foreign Minister on the principle of reciprocity, diplomatic requirements.”

- Amend and supplement Point dd of Clause 4 as follows:

“dd) Conferences and festivals organized by the central committee of the Communist Party of Vietnam, the President, the National Assembly, the Standing Committee of the National Assembly, the Government of Vietnam, or the Prime Minister of the Government of Vietnam attended by the protected subjects specified in Points a, b, c, or d of Clause 1 of this Article; the national delegate congress organized by central socio-political organizations; international conferences held in Vietnam attended by the protected subjects specified in Points a, b, c, d of Clause 1 or Point a of Clause 2 of this Article.”

- Amend and supplement Clause 5 and add Clause 6 after Clause 5 as follows:

“5. Based on the political security situation in different periods, the Government of Vietnam shall present to the Standing Committee of the National Assembly for approval, the inclusion of additional protected subjects and the application of suitable protective measures and policies according to Articles 11, 11a, 12, 12a, 13, and 14 of this Law.

  1. In necessary cases to protect national security, ensure social order and safety, and guarantee foreign affairs activities, the Minister of Public Security shall decide on the appropriate protective measures for subjects not specified in Clauses 1, 2, 3, 4, and 5 of this Article.”

Law amending Law on Security Guard Force 2024 takes effect in Vietnam from January 1, 2025.
